楼主: liuliuqiu
2466 13

[有偿编程] excel导入matalb [推广有奖]

  • 6关注
  • 2粉丝

已卖:35份资源

副教授

64%

还不是VIP/贵宾

-

威望
0
论坛币
2239 个
通用积分
8.1161
学术水平
3 点
热心指数
5 点
信用等级
5 点
经验
14393 点
帖子
429
精华
0
在线时间
1129 小时
注册时间
2009-3-24
最后登录
2025-12-11

楼主
liuliuqiu 发表于 2017-4-13 15:54:46 |AI写论文
5论坛币
excel表有4000列,如何导入MATLAB?导入后想进行矩阵计算
现在只能导入255列

最佳答案

67890 查看完整内容

try the matlab to Excel link file. It is a excel add-on from Matlab. You can define Matlab variables in Excel. That may work for you.
关键词:matalb EXCEL exce MATA xcel

沙发
67890 发表于 2017-4-13 15:54:47
try the matlab to Excel link file. It is a excel add-on from Matlab. You can define Matlab variables in Excel. That may work for you.

藤椅
tony_mxl 发表于 2017-4-13 16:10:43
如果真的只能一次性导入255列,一个比较笨但却直观的方法是选择用4000/255(约等于16)个矩阵变量来存储数据,再在matlab中将其合并成一个矩阵即可

板凳
liuliuqiu 发表于 2017-4-13 17:19:25
tony_mxl 发表于 2017-4-13 16:10
如果真的只能一次性导入255列,一个比较笨但却直观的方法是选择用4000/255(约等于16)个矩阵变量来存储数据 ...
没有什么好办法吗?因为好几个excel表,一个个这么做实在是太麻烦了

报纸
liuliuqiu 发表于 2017-4-13 17:19:42
顶,各位帮帮忙

地板
Terry950901 在职认证  发表于 2017-4-13 17:22:15
楼主可以尝试使用以下stattransfer,很方便的。

7
liuliuqiu 发表于 2017-4-13 17:25:34
Terry950901 发表于 2017-4-13 17:22
楼主可以尝试使用以下stattransfer,很方便的。
谢谢,我试了,但excel文件太大,软件没法转换

8
1162481939 发表于 2017-4-14 08:16:30
可以倒入很多的
xlsread  直接读取,可能与软件版本有问题
已有 1 人评分学术水平 热心指数 信用等级 收起 理由
liuliuqiu + 3 + 3 + 3 热心帮助其他会员

总评分: 学术水平 + 3  热心指数 + 3  信用等级 + 3   查看全部评分

9
24578901 在职认证  发表于 2017-4-14 08:46:36
Excel 1997 和 Excel 2003 中,工作表的大小为 256 列 × 65,536 行
Excel 2010 和 Excel 2007 中,工作表的大小为 16,384 列 × 1,048,576 行

尝试吧xls转换成xlsx格式,不行的话,试着csv或tex吧、、、、
我也没有实践过、、、
已有 1 人评分学术水平 热心指数 信用等级 收起 理由
liuliuqiu + 3 + 3 + 3 热心帮助其他会员

总评分: 学术水平 + 3  热心指数 + 3  信用等级 + 3   查看全部评分

10
ADD_Wang 发表于 2017-4-14 09:22:45
直接读取读取不出来么?不至于只能读取200多列吧。

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群
GMT+8, 2025-12-26 04:30